The P car is not as light on its feet as you might think. I drive on the scale after each run and with me in the car, 1/3 tank of gas, weight was 3,560 lbs.
Yeah, that's kinda my point...

These cars keep getting more complicated and heavier, plus the PDK trans & associated hardware add another 90lb.s weight to your S over a 6-speed 997.2S (according to the official specs on the Porsche website). But you've proven that it compensates for those extra pounds quite well - on a 1/4 mile strip at least...
